Apple Picking Adventures

One of the quintessential activities for many during fall is heading out to pick apples fresh from the tree. Atlanta is home to several charming orchards where you can indulge in this experience. Head on over to B.J. Reece Orchards, Hillcrest Orchards, Mercier Orchards, or Jaemor Farms. These places offer you the chance to pluck ripe apples straight from the branches, an experience that’s both rewarding and heartwarming. Pumpkin Picking Perfection

No autumn experience is complete without a visit to a pumpkin patch, and Atlanta does not disappoint. Traverse through patches filled with pumpkins waiting to be picked. Whether you’re looking to carve a jack-o’-lantern or decorate your home with an autumnal flair, finding the perfect pumpkin is a joy. Consider visiting Burt’s Farm, the Oakland Cemetery Pumpkin Patch, Scottsdale Farm, or Southern Belle Farm. Each of these locations offers a unique pumpkin picking experience that will leave you with lasting memories and, hopefully, the ideal pumpkin!

Sunflowers and Family Fun

If sunflowers are your floral favorites, a trip to Fausett Farms is a must. As you walk through the stunning fields of yellow, you’ll feel a sense of serene charm enveloping you. And if you’re visiting with family or friends, head to Sleepy Hallow Farm, Uncle Shuck’s, or Washington Farms to enjoy a day packed with family-friendly activities. From navigating through intricate corn mazes to laughing on bouncy hayrides, there’s plenty to keep everyone entertained. These farms also host engaging games that add an extra layer of fun to your visit.
